— English words —
  • douth n. (Obsolete) Virtue; excellence; atheldom; nobility; power; riches.
  • douth n. (Obsolete) A group of people, especially an army or retinue.
  • douth n. (Dialectal) Reliability; ease; security; shelter.
  • douth adj. (Dialectal) Snug; comfortable; in easy circumstances.
  • douth n. Alternative form of dought.
